  • Community Expert
Mar 16 21:13:01 unRAID root: Fix Common Problems: Warning: Share Backups set to not use the cache, but files / folders exist on the cache drive
Mar 16 21:13:07 unRAID root: Fix Common Problems: Warning: Deprecated plugin Unraid-Nvidia.plg

Backups is set to cache-no. Mover ignores cache-no shares. You must set it to cache-yes to get files moved from it.  And you should remove the deprecated plugin

 

The very last thing in your syslog is

Mar 16 22:21:15 unRAID root: mover: started

but there are no messages from mover logging after that even though your diagnostics have a timestamp of 22:27, several minutes later.

 

11 hours ago, trurl said:

Go to Scheduler Settings and enable Mover Logging

Did you?

 

Mar 16 21:13:07 unRAID root: Fix Common Problems: Error: Unable to write to cache

If cache really is unwriteable, mover can't move anything off cache. You will have to fix cache problem before you can make any progress. I didn't notice anything about cache corruption in these latest diagnostics, except for a corrupt docker.img which may be on cache but since your system share has files on the array also can't say for sure. system share should be cache-prefer or only instead of cache-yes as you have it. Might be best to set it to cache-only for now so mover will ignore it until we make room on cache.

 

Disable Docker in Settings and delete the corrupt docker.img. Also disable VM Manager in Settings. Leave them both disabled until all your other problems are resolved.

  • Community Expert
23 hours ago, trurl said:

your system share has files on the array ... system share should be cache-prefer or only instead of cache-yes as you have it.

Dockers/VMs will perform better on fast pool and won't keep array disks spunup since these files are always open. You might consider changing that setting for your domains share also.

 

You will have to disable Docker and VM Manager since nothing can move open files, set system and domains to cache-prefer, then run mover to get those moved to cache.
